Tray Deee spoke to VladTV about Lil D saying that his few years of balling out weren't worth the nearly three decades that he spent in prison, which Tray Deee agreed with. He added that nothing is worth the tradeoff of long term jail time, and explained that he longed for such nuisances like being in traffic while he was locked up. To hear more, including Tray Deee knowing of longterm criminals that haven't been snitched on, hit the above clip.
